What to know about Payment Technologies

Payment Technologies encompass a rapidly evolving landscape shaping how money moves in today’s digital economy. From advancements in contactless and mobile payments to innovations in cross-border transactions and fraud prevention, this tag explores the cutting-edge tools and collaborations redefining convenience, security, and efficiency in payments.

Our latest stories highlight significant developments such as partnerships enhancing seamless shopping experiences, fintech startups pioneering new payment solutions, and the integration of AI to combat fraud. Emerging topics like stablecoins, biometric authentication, and cloud-based payment security services illustrate the expanding scope and complexity of payment technologies.

For businesses and consumers alike, understanding these trends is essential to navigating the future of commerce. By following the Payment Technologies tag, readers gain insight into how innovations are influencing global markets, improving customer experiences, and enabling new opportunities in an increasingly interconnected world.
